Jamie Miles: The Crafty DIY Guy

Jamie Miles, known to his growing YouTube community as "The Crafty DIY Guy," is a dynamic creator with a passion for all things DIY. From budget-friendly Dollar Tree crafts to thrift store makeovers and even some mini home renovations, Jamie brings creativity and flair to every project. His journey as a homeowner began in 2018, and his need for affordable solutions quickly turned into a love for DIY projects that resonate with thousands.

With over 100,000 subscribers, Jamie has built a loyal following by showcasing cost-effective DIYs, lifestyle hacks, meal ideas, and fashion tips—particularly for "Brawn" guys looking to look their best on a budget. Beyond crafting and lifestyle content, Jamie is also a licensed REALTOR in the state of Georgia, helping clients find their perfect homes while sharing his real estate expertise.
 

In addition to his work in DIY and real estate, Jamie is a seasoned actor with notable TV and film credits. A proud member of SAG-AFTRA* (E), he has appeared in co-starring roles on hit shows such as The Resident (FOX), Watchmen (HBO), The Inspectors (CBS), Halt & Catch Fire (AMC), and in commercials for major brands like AT&T Wireless and Doritos.

Jamie’s expertise, whether in DIY, real estate, or acting, continues to inspire and connect audiences across multiple platforms.

Creating these candle houses is a fun and affordable DIY project that anyone can do! You can find all the supplies at your local Dollar Store or craft store for less than $10, including the candles.

Here's what you'll need to get started:

Supplies:

  • 2 Box-Style Faux Wood Signs
  • 10 Wooden Dowel Rods

Additional Materials:

  • Hot Glue Gun and Glue Sticks
  • Paint (Spray Paint works great!)
  • Decorative Rocks
  • Small Glass Candle
  • Lineman Pliers or Wire Cutters

Instructions

  1. Choose Your Box Signs:
    Find wood box-style signs at your local dollar store. Look for ones with a built-in frame design. The printed design doesn’t matter, as you’ll be painting over it. If you want variety, pick different sizes to create multiple candle houses.
  2. Prepare the Dowel Rods:
    Use pliers or wire cutters to cut 4 dowel rods to the same length, between 7–10 inches, depending on your desired house size.
  3. Attach the Corner Posts:
    Flip the box sign upside down so the framed edge faces upward. Glue the dowel rods vertically to the four corners of the box using hot glue. Let the glue set firmly.
  4. Build the Roof Base:
    Take another dowel rod, cut it to fit across two of the corner posts at the top, and glue it in place. Repeat this process to connect the remaining corners, creating a square frame for the roof.
  5. Create the Pitched Roof:
    Cut 4 more dowel rods to about 4 inches each. Form a triangular shape at one end of the roof by gluing two rods together at an angle, connecting them to the square roof base. Repeat on the opposite side of the structure.
  6. Add the Roof Ridge:
    Connect the two triangular roof ends by gluing a dowel rod along the top peak to complete the pitched roof structure.
  7. Paint and Decorate:
    Once the glue is dry, take your house structure outside and spray paint it in your favorite color. Let the paint dry completely.
  8. Add Finishing Touches:
    Place decorative rocks, faux plants, or other embellishments at the base. Add a small glass candle in the center, and your stylish candle house is ready!

Styling Tips:  Make several houses in varying heights and sizes for a big visual impact. They look great on a fireplace mantel, coffee table, or as part of a centerpiece. These DIY candle houses are simple to create but make a stunning statement!
